Cultural relativity teaches, rather similar to subjectivism, that, "x is moral or not if and only if x is believed by the culture to be moral or not, when the culture believes it to be moral or not, for that culture." Does belief in this theory encourage tolerance, mutual acceptance and peace between different cultures. Or allow and encourage the opposite? And can we use Cultural Relativity to push back against the Nihilist?
